From assembly line to call centre, this volume charts the immense transformation of work and pay across the 20th century and provides the first labor-focused history of Britain. Written by leading British historians and economists, each chapter stands as a self-contained reading for those who need an overview of the topic, as well as an introduction to and analysis of the controversies among scholars for readers entering or refreshing deeper study. The 20th century was a period of unrivalled change in the British labor market. Technology, social movements, and political action all contributed to an increased standard of living, while also revolutionizing what workers do and how they do it. Covering a range of topics from lifetime work patterns and education to unemployment and the welfare state, this book provides a practical introduction to the evolution of work and pay in 20th century Britain.

"This is an important and interesting book. The chapters of this book, each written by appropriate experts, dig down and uncover the forces at work and the complex interactions between them. The rise and fall of trade unions, the rise of the service sector, the decline in fertility, the fall and rise of earnings dispersion are some of the dramatic changes which are analysed and explained. Overall, the book builds a picture of the workings of the 20th century British labour market which will fascinate anyone interested in how the world works."--Stephen Nickell, Warden of Nuffield College, Oxford University "The British labor market experienced a series of dramatic transformations in the course of the 20th century. Is the current regime of high employment and wage flexibility here to stay, or is it just another passing phase? Do Britain's arrangements reflect a distinctive historical experience, or might they be emulated by Continental Europe? This important book by Crafts, Gazeley and Newell provides the perspective needed to contemplate these questions."--Barry Eichengreen, University of California, Berkeley, "This is an important and interesting book. Table of Content
Introduction, Ian Gazeley and Andrew Newell1. Living standards, Nicholas Crafts2. Structural change, Andrew Newell3. Manual Work and Pay, 1900-1970, Ian Gazeley4. Wages and wage inequality 1970-2000, Florence Kondylis and Jonathan Wadsworth5. Work over the life course, Paul Johnson and Asghar Zaidi6. The household and the labour market, Sara Horrell7. Women and work 1970-2000, Sara Connolly and Mary Gregory8. The 'Welfare State' and the labour market, Pat Thane9. Industrial relations, Christopher Wrigley10. Unemployment, Ian Gazeley and Andrew Newell11. Education and the labour market, Michael Sanderson12. Britain's twentieth century productivity performance in international perspective, Stephen Broadberry and Mary O'Mahony13. Immigration and the labour market, Dudley Baines
